Chrysalis Theatre

Fueled by the intersection of theatre, dance and performance art, Chrysalis Theatre is dedicated to training, producing, and touring original dance and theatre works. This dedication has sparked interests in noise music, collage, found text, theatre, dance, gender bending, and site specific performance, resulting in four full-length pieces.

Critics Praise for LOUNGE

Colin Thomas, The Georgia Straight

"quietly vunerable....it's hypnotizing. Marquardt presents the chanteuse with a combination of pain and girlish cover-up; the performers considerable beauty helps to make this intriguing."


Jo Ledingham, The Vancouver Courier

"Tanya Marquardt. Remember that name. She's going to be a star."


Rob Salerno, Xtra West

"This play will seduce you..."


Michael Harris, The Globe and Mail

" Tanya Marquardt's one woman show about an unnamed singer just stopping in town for a gig has all the hallmarks of a gin-soaked, down-and-out lounge act...one of the more physically striking young actresses in town."
